We tested the activity of anidulafungin against 30Candida albicans isolates. The planktonic MICs for 50 and 90% of the isolates tested (MIC50 and MIC90 ) were ≤0.03 and 0.125 μg/ml, respectively (MIC range, ≤0.03 to 2 μg/ml). The sessile MIC50 and MIC90 were ≤0.03 and ≤0.03 μg/ml, respectively (MIC range, ≤0.03 to >16 μg/ml).
